Helium Summary: The Trump administration's immigration policies are provoking significant controversy, legal challenges, and public outcry.

This includes proposals to end birthright citizenship, deportations to Guantanamo Bay, and increased ICE raids.

Conservative media support these policies as necessary for safety and law enforcement , while liberal outlets critique them as harsh and unconstitutional . NYC Mayor Adams's cooperation with ICE raises further ethical questions , and religious groups oppose immigration raids at churches . These events highlight deep political divides and questions of human rights and legality .

What legal challenges is Trump's immigration policy facing?

Trump's policies face courts blocking deportations to Guantanamo Bay and challenges against attempts to end birthright citizenship, alleging constitutional violations .


How has NYC Mayor Eric Adams involved himself with the Trump administration?

Adams is cooperating with the Trump administration to enhance ICE operations, though this has sparked allegations of political quid pro quo .




Narratives + Biases (?)


Conservative sources such as FOX News and The Gateway Pundit often frame Trump's immigration policies as essential for national safety and enforcing legality, portraying critics as ignoring law enforcement needs . Conversely, liberal outlets like The Atlantic and Common Dreams emphasize human rights and humanitarian concerns, critiquing the policies as unconstitutional and excessively harsh . There is a noted ideological divide where conservative and liberal media prioritize different aspects and implications of the same policies.

Evaluating these narratives requires recognizing underlying partisan leanings and considering broader societal impacts and legal frameworks.
